The first trailer for the posh drama The Riot Club has been released! Based on the award-winning West End play by Laura Wade, The Riot Club follows the journey of two male first year students, who find themselves striving to be part of ‘The Riot Club’ – a barely veiled representation of Oxford’s notorious Bullingdon Club, which counts Prime Minister David Cameron and Mayor of London Boris Johnson among its past members.
Directed by Lone Scherfig (An Eductation) and set at Oxford University (“where rich kids first taste power”),the story follows the course of one riotous evening gone bad for a bunch of young, spoilt-rotten students.
The cast includes Max Irons (The White Queen), Douglas Booth (Noah), Freddie Fox (Parade’s End), and The Hunger Games‘ Sam Claflin. Downton Abbey‘s Jessica Brown-Findlay will also star, alongside Holliday Grainger (Great Expectations) and Game of Thrones actress Natalie Dormer.
The Riot Club comes roaring into UK theaters on September 19th.
